“Recording now available!
We are grateful to our expert faculty for sharing their time, and their thoughtful discussions, and insights during our recent webinar:
Apixaban vs. Rivaroxaban in Acute VTE: Uncoiling COBRRA and Its Clinical Implications
This session explored the clinical questions behind the COBRRA trial, including retrospective evidence, potential pharmacologic explanations, study design, key findings, and practical implications for frontline VTE care.
